Grammar usage guide and real-world examplesUSAGE SUMMARY
The phrase "forms of leadership" is correct and usable in written English.
You can use it when discussing different styles, types, or approaches to leadership in various contexts, such as business, education, or politics. Example: "In today's seminar, we will explore various forms of leadership and their impact on team dynamics."

FAQs
How can I use "forms of leadership" in a sentence?
You can use "forms of leadership" to discuss various styles or methods of leading, such as "The company is exploring new "forms of leadership" to improve employee engagement".
What are some alternatives to "forms of leadership"?
Alternatives include "leadership styles", "leadership methods", or "leadership approaches", depending on the specific aspect you want to emphasize.
Is it correct to say "form of leadership" or "forms of leadership"?
Both are correct, but "form of leadership" refers to a single style or method, while "forms of leadership" indicates multiple styles or methods being discussed.
What's the difference between "leadership styles" and "forms of leadership"?
"Leadership styles" is generally used to categorize leaders based on their behavior, while "forms of leadership" can encompass broader organizational structures or approaches to leading, not just individual styles.
